Victor matrix BS-030360. Margie / Don Redman Orchestra
| Title | Source |
|---|---|
| Margie (Primary title) | Disc label |
| Fox trot (Title descriptor) | Disc label |
| Authors and Composers | Notes |
| Benny Davis (lyricist) | |
| Con Conrad (composer) | |
| J. Russel Robinson (composer) | |
| Composer information source: Disc label; sheet music. | |
| Personnel | Notes |
| Don Redman Orchestra (Musical group) | |
| Leonard W. Joy (session supervisor) | |
| Don Redman (director) | |
| Don Redman (vocalist) | |
Additional Information
- Description: Jazz/dance band, with male vocal solo and vocal ensemble
- Instrumentation: 5 saxophones, 3 trumpets, 2 trombones, guitar, piano, string bass, and traps
- Category: Instrumental with vocal refrain
- Language: English
- Master Size: 10-in.
